Why Small Texas Businesses Need a Different Kind of Agency
Most marketing agencies are built to serve $5M+ companies. Their pricing, processes, and minimums don't fit the realities of a $200K – $2M Texas small business. You need an agency that thinks like an owner — fast experiments, lean spend, fast iteration, real accountability.
The 10-Minute Agency Filter
- Do they have a small business case study with revenue numbers, not "engagement"?
- Is there a real human (not a chatbot) on their site contact form?
- Are their reviews on Google, Clutch, and other independent third parties?
- Do they offer month-to-month after a short initial commitment?
- Do they require you to give up ownership of any account or asset? (Walk away if yes.)
What to Pay in Texas in 2026
- Foundation (one channel, well done): $1,000 – $2,500/month
- Growth (multi-channel): $2,500 – $6,000/month
- Aggressive scale: $6,000 – $15,000/month
The Three Outcomes a Real Agency Drives
- Lead volume up month over month.
- Cost per lead down or stable as volume grows.
- Revenue from marketing tracked end-to-end in a dashboard you own.
